Как организованы проверочные пространства проектирования

Как организованы проверочные пространства проектирования

Испытательная пространство создания является собой обособленное среду для проверки программного ПО. Инженеры выстраивают обособленную структуру, которая воспроизводит действительные условия функционирования системы. Такая архитектура включает серверы, базы данных, сетевые составляющие и иные технические составляющие.

Группы создания задействуют казино без депозита для надежного тестирования новых функций. Изолированное среда дает проверять код без опасности сломать действующий приложение. Эксперты запускают приложение в контролируемых обстоятельствах и изучают его функционирование.

Построение тестового среды дублирует организацию производственной системы. Инженеры конфигурируют настройки, устанавливают зависимости и готовят информацию для испытания. Каждый элемент платформы призван действовать так же как боевой итерации.

Процесс построения тестового окружения требует немалых мощностей. Предприятия резервируют вычислительные возможности, хранилища информации и сетевую структуру. Правильно настроенная система способствует обнаруживать баги на ранних стадиях разработки. Профессиональное испытание снижает объем дефектов в заключительном выпуске решения.

Зачем необходимы самостоятельные среды для испытания

Обособленные среды для испытания предохраняют продуктовые среды от непредсказуемых эффектов. Новый код способен иметь критические баги, которые приведут к отказам в работе приложения. Отдельное пространство позволяет определить проблемы до их попадания к конечным потребителям.

Специалисты испытывают с разнообразными подходами исполнения возможностей. Проверочное окружение дает волю тестировать необычные подходы без беспокойства повредить организации. Группы могут отменять правки и инициировать валидацию сначала в произвольный момент.

Параллельная работа нескольких экспертов требует независимых окружений. Каждый разработчик тестирует свои модификации, не препятствуя партнерам. Обособление устраняет столкновения между отличающимися редакциями казино и форсирует процесс проектирования.

Безопасность данных пользователей сохраняется приоритетом при тестировании. Подлинная данные клиентов не обязана эксплуатироваться в опытах. Отдельная платформа взаимодействует с фиктивными данными, которые имитируют подлинные сведения. Такой метод предотвращает раскрытия закрытой сведений и соблюдает предписания права о обеспечении персональных информации.

Чем тестовая платформа отличается от производственной

Тестовая платформа использует сокращенную структуру по сравнению с рабочей системой. Компании оптимизируют средства, распределяя меньше серверных мощностей для испытания приложения. Продуктовое пространство обрабатывает вызовы тысяч потребителей параллельно, тогда как тестовое окружение предназначено на минимальную загрузку.

Сведения в испытательной системе представляют собой автоматически сформированные информацию. Программисты формируют информацию, которая дублирует формат подлинных данных клиентов. Производственная хранилище содержит свежие сведения клиентов и запрашивает усиленных мер обеспечения.

Отслеживание и логирование работают отлично в двух категориях пространств. Испытательное окружение собирает подробную сведения о каждой процессе для исследования казино онлайн и выявления проблем. Боевая инфраструктура регистрирует только существенные инциденты, чтобы не переполнять накопители данных.

Доступ к тестовой платформе получают программисты и тестировщики по качеству. Рабочее среда доступно для финальных пользователей и нуждается строгого регулирования модификаций. Всякое обновление рабочей платформы предполагает многоэтапное одобрение, тогда как тестовая среда позволяет оперативно делать модификации для испытаний.

Как создаются дубликаты приложений для валидации

Процесс разворачивания дубликата системы инициируется с дублирования первоначального программы из репозитория. Инженеры получают текущую релиз системы и размещают модули на тестовых машинах. Инструмент управления редакций помогает определить требуемую ревизию для установки.

Конфигурационные данные адаптируются под характеристики испытательного среды. Эксперты определяют пути баз данных, параметры сетевых каналов и технологические характеристики. Корректная конфигурация гарантирует стабильную эксплуатацию продукта в отдельном окружении.

База сведений клонируется с помощью инструментов переноса. Группы делают снимок производственной базы и транспортируют архитектуру таблиц в испытательное хранилище. Секретные данные меняются замаскированными данными для соблюдения политики защиты.

Автоматическое развертывание размещения повышает скорость построение бездепозитный бонус и снижает шанс дефектов. Автоматизации выполняют инструкции для установки модулей и старта компонентов. Контейнеризация обеспечивает упаковать приложение в автономный блок. Такой прием предоставляет единообразие окружений на разных фазах создания.

Какие типы тестовых сред встречаются

Окружение разработки рассчитана для написания и исправления программы разработчиками. Каждый сотрудник функционирует на собственном устройстве или персональном узле. Разработчики незамедлительно вносят правки и испытывают базовую функции блоков.

Интеграционная система сливает код от нескольких членов команды. Платформа самостоятельно компилирует систему и активирует валидации интеграции элементов. Данный тип пространства определяет несовместимости между модулями казино без депозита на стартовой периоде.

Окружение валидации эксплуатируется тестировщиками по проверке для детальной проверки функциональности. Эксперты исполняют сценарии работы и фиксируют выявленные дефекты. Окружение включает проверенную версию приложения для регулярного изучения.

Предпродакшн система в высшей степени близка к производственной платформе. Группы реализуют итоговую тестирование перед запуском обновлений. Подобное пространство позволяет определить недостатки производительности и совместимости с реальной системой.

Демонстрационная система разворачивается для демонстраций пользователям. Платформа включает сформированные информацию и сконфигурированные последовательности демонстрации функций продукта.

Как проверяются новые функции

Тестирование свежих функциональности инициируется с анализа спецификаций к создаваемому компоненту. Специалисты анализируют описание и составляют перечень тестов для проверки работы продукта. Каждая функция призвана отвечать описанным характеристикам.

Юнит испытание проверяет отдельные части софта в обособлении. Специалисты разрабатывают программные испытания, которые активируют процедуры и проверяют результаты с прогнозируемыми результатами. Подобный способ помогает быстро выявлять баги в структуре системы.

Интеграционное тестирование проверяет сопряжение свежей возможности с существующими блоками. Команды испытывают пересылку сведений между модулями и правильность выполнения вызовов. Тестировщики применяют средства для симуляции множественных вариантов казино функционирования.

Функциональное испытание выполняется с перспективы зрения конечного пользователя. Сотрудники реализуют стандартные кейсы работы и испытывают совпадение выходов требованиям. Коллектив документирует выявленные дефекты для правки.

Регрессионное испытание обеспечивает, что свежий софт не нарушил эксплуатацию текущей возможностей.

Почему необходимо отделять дефекты

Обособление ошибок предотвращает проникновение неполадок на рабочую среду. Серьезная неполадка в продуктовой системе вероятно вызвать к исчезновению сведений пользователей и блокировке деятельности. Тестовое среда позволяет обнаружить ошибку до ее выхода к пользователям.

Обнаружение ошибок повышает скорость процесс исправления устранения. Инженеры ясно находят компонент с багом и направляют усилия на правке точного фрагмента кода. Изолированная проверка исключает воздействие остальных компонентов казино онлайн на итоги исследования.

Проверочная платформа формирует защищенное среду для испытаний с правками. Группы пробуют множественные подходы корректировки без угрозы обострить состояние.

Отделение дефектов создает следующие плюсы:

  • Обеспечение репутации компании от негативных отзывов;
  • Сокращение экономических издержек от неработоспособности системы;
  • Сохранение доверия клиентов к системе;
  • Минимизация времени на поиск источника ошибки.

Документирование изолированных неполадок содействует избежать повторение проблем в дальнейшем. Команды анализируют источники багов и развивают методы построения.

Как команды взаимодействуют с испытательными пространствами

Группы создания применяют механизм регулирования правами для функционирования с испытательными окружениями. Каждый сотрудник обретает регистрационные данные с установленными привилегиями в корреляции от роли. Инженеры устанавливают код, специалисты инициируют валидации, техники контролируют инфраструктурой.

Процесс запуска правок соответствует утвержденному протоколу. Программисты сохраняют код в репозитории и генерируют обращение на интеграцию. Автоматизированная механизм строит программу и располагает измененную релиз в проверочном среде.

Взаимодействие между специалистами реализуется через механизм контроля заданий. Разработчики фиксируют обнаруженные неполадки, определяют ответственных и контролируют положение операций. Открытость практик позволяет эффективно выделять казино ресурсы и мониторить периоды.

Периодические совещания группы анализируют выходы проверки и намечают предстоящие действия. Члены обмениваются информацией о ошибках и предлагают варианты. Коллективная активность стимулирует корректировку ошибок.

Описание процессов позволяет свежим сотрудникам быстро освоить работу с испытательными окружениями.

Функция тестовых сред в устойчивости приложения

Тестовые окружения образуют фундамент для достижения надежности программного решения. Систематическая испытание правок в отдельном среде сокращает число дефектов в боевой платформе. Группы определяют фатальные ошибки до выпуска и предотвращают неблагоприятное воздействие на пользователей.

Постоянное проверка сохраняет хорошее состояние кодовой базы. Программные валидации запускаются после каждого изменения и уведомляют о неполадках согласованности. Программисты приобретают обратную связь о действии обновлений на работу казино онлайн системы.

Стабильность поведения программы реализуется через многоступенчатое проверку. Каждая возможность претерпевает проверку на отличающихся периодах в специализированных средах. Целостный прием подтверждает соответствие системы нормам уровня.

Сокращение опасностей при релизе апдейтов казино без депозита обусловлена от уровня проверки. Коллективы эксплуатируют препродуктовую инфраструктуру для итоговой подтверждения перед размещением. Данная практика охраняет дело от экономических издержек.

Перспективная надежность приложения нуждается постоянного улучшения подходов валидации и роста инфраструктуры.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top